Urologic Cancer Unit

The UC San Diego Moores Urologic Cancer Unit offers leading-edge approaches to the diagnosis, treatment, and prognosis of urologic cancers and other genitourinary diseases. Because urologic cancers often require a variety of treatments, we use a multidisciplinary — or team — approach involving urologic surgeons, medical oncologists, and radiation oncologists. We have the clinical knowledge and collaborative approach to provide you with the optimal therapy based on your unique case.

Services

As a patient, you have access to some of the country’s leading urologic cancer experts and a wide range of cancer care services, including:

  • Screening examinations
  • Transrectal ultrasound and biopsy
  • Diagnostic imaging
  • Second opinions for those with a diagnosis of urological cancer
  • Access to new or investigational treatment regimens
  • Personalized psychosocial assessment and support program 
  • Management of treatment-induced changes in urinary control or sexual function
  • Financial and insurance counseling
  • Cancer nutritional counseling
  • Risk and prevention genetic counseling
  • Surgical options to preserve urinary continence, fertility, and sexual function for selected patients with cancers of the bladder, testis, and prostate
